Alabama State vs. Huntingdon College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, Alabama State or Huntingdon College?

  • Huntingdon College is 226% more expensive to attend than Alabama State for in-state tuition ($27,150.00 vs. $8,328.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 63% higher at Huntingdon College than Alabama State University ($27,150.00 vs. $16,656.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at Alabama State University than Huntingdon College ($13,504 vs. $22,642)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Alabama State University are 42% lower than costs at Huntingdon College ($7,690 vs. $10,922)
  • More students receive financial grant aid at Huntingdon College than Alabama State University (100% vs. 88%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by Huntingdon College students is 57.7% larger than aid received Alabama State University ($17,303 vs. $10,971)

Alabama State vs. Huntingdon College Admissions Difficulty Comparison

Which college is harder to get into, Alabama State or Huntingdon College? Average SAT and ACT scores plus acceptance rates offer good insight into the difficulty of admission between Huntingdon College or Alabama State .

  • The average SAT score at Huntingdon College (992) is 148 points higher than at Alabama State (844)
  • Incoming Huntingdon College students have a 3 point higher average ACT score (21) than students at Alabama State (18)
  • Accepted freshman Huntingdon College students have a 0.48 point higher average high school GPA (3.43) than students at Alabama State (2.95)
  • Alabama State has a higher acceptance rate (95.6%) than Huntingdon College (70.8%)

Alabama State vs. Huntingdon College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, Alabama State or Huntingdon College?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between Huntingdon College and Alabama State.

  • The graduation rate at Huntingdon College is higher than Alabama State University (52% vs. 26%)
  • Graduates from Huntingdon College earn on average $12,900 more per year than Alabama State graduates after ten years. ($42,400 vs. $29,500)
  • Huntingdon College students graduate with a $5,614 lower median federal student loan debt than Alabama State graduates. ($26,477 vs. $32,091)
  • Huntingdon College graduates are paying $58 less per month on federal student loans than Alabama State graduates. ($273 vs. $331)
  • More Huntingdon College gra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former Alabama State students, three years after graduation. (50% vs. 20%)
